Open cast mining method with single bench, deploying HEMM and conducting deep hole blasting is in practice.The sizing of ROM limestone is carried out by four nos. fully mechanized Sizing & screening plants of the total capacity 20.00 lac MT per annum.The different size products are dispatched from mines as well as by rail from Jaisalmer Railway sidings of the company.

Museum | Thingbaek Limestone mine and RebildCentret

The limestone mines. While limestone has been mined at the surface level for generations, the Thingbaek limestone mine was first opened in 1926. The mine was in operation until 1960, where it became unprofitable. The mines were already open to the public in 1935 and housed sculptures by Anders Bundgaard.

Limestone Industry, Kentucky Geological Survey, University ...

Sep 12, 2019· Two mines along the Ohio River in north-central Kentucky (Outer Bluegrass Region) are producing stone from the Camp Nelson Limestone for the manufacture of low-magnesium and high-calcium limes. The limes are used for flue-gas desulfurization at coal-fired power plants, and for steel-furnace flux, chemical manufacture, and water treatment.

Limestone mining operations in Rajasthan put on hold by ...

Sep 29, 2021· New Delhi, Sep 29 (IANS): The National Green Tribunal (NGT) has said that limestone mining operations, within 10 kms of Bassi Wildlife Sanctuary in Rajasthan's Chittorgarh, will remain prohibited till the expert panel conducts a detailed study of its impact beyond the boundaries of the eco-sensitive zone. Limestone—A Crucial and Versatile Industrial Mineral …

Some Issues in Limestone Mining. Limestone is most often mined from a quarry. However, underground limestone . mines are found at places in the central and eastern United States, especially in and near cities. Underground mining of lime - stone has some advantages over surface quarrying and will probably increase in the future.

Limestone, Shell, Dolomite | Florida Department of ...

The Mining and Mitigation Program administers reclamation, environmental resource/stormwater management, and federally-delegated dredge and fill (State 404) permit programs for mining operations in Florida, including limestone, shell and dolomite mines. Reclamation standards for limestone, shell and dolomite mining are detailed in Part II of Chapter 211, Florida Statutes
